2,147,548,668 is a composite number, even.
2,147,548,668 (two billion one hundred forty-seven million five hundred forty-eight thousand six hundred sixty-eight) is an even 10-digit number. It is a composite number with 24 divisors, and factors as 2² × 3 × 1,117 × 160,217. Its proper divisors sum to 2,867,915,604, more than the number itself, making it an abundant number.
